🙂Monthly costs for one person with rent: $791 in Fuzhou versus $1,467 in Mexico City.
🙂Estimated couple costs with rent: $1,278 in Fuzhou versus $2,371 in Mexico City.
🙂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$1,766 in Fuzhou versus $3,274 in Mexico City.
🙂Living in Fuzhou costs roughly 46% less than in Mexico City, driven mainly by Eating Out.
📊The two cities straddle the global median: Fuzhou is 41% below, Mexico City is 10% above.

🏠A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$354 in Fuzhou and $1,022 in Mexico City.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.
💰Mexico City pays 15% more on average. The extra income cushions the higher costs, though housing choices and lifestyle decide how much of the gap is truly closed.
🛒Dining out: $23.00 in Fuzhou vs $54.0 in Mexico City for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$211 vs $288 per month, with Fuzhou cheaper across the board.
